what is a good way to bring your mana down if youve already gmed magery...but not meditation?

by MatronDeWinter
Get a bunch of nightshade and set a macro to cast poison at about 4 mana above the percent of the total mana you have that you would gain at ((100-skill)%). Just cast poison because it takes a single nightshade, and takes very close to 10 mana (well 9) which will keep you more or less +/- 5 mana in either direction from where you should be actively meditating.
I recently did this on a warrior with gm med, and it took less than a day from 30-GM and only 2000 nightshade or so.
